1. Knotless Box Braids
Knotless box braids have quickly become a fan favorite for anyone with natural hair.
Unlike traditional box braids, they don’t have the bulky knots at the base, making them gentler on your scalp and hair.
I love how these braids give my hair a neat, sleek look while keeping it safe from damage.

2. Cornrows with Zig-Zag Part
Cornrows are a classic protective hairstyle, but the zig-zag part takes it up a notch!
This style is visually striking and adds some personality to the traditional cornrow look. I
usually go for this one when I’m looking to keep my hair out of my face while still having fun with the design.
This works great for all hair types, and it’s especially perfect for people who want a low-maintenance, stylish look that doesn’t require daily styling.

4. Senegalese Twists Ponytail
Senegalese twists are another protective hairstyle that I absolutely swear by.
The ponytail version is great for showing off the length and texture of the twists while keeping the hair out of your face. It’s perfect for people with medium to thick hair, as the twists are durable and add a lot of volume.
To get the look, just gather your twists into a high ponytail, add a cute hair accessory, and you’re good to go!

9. Flat Twist Updo
Flat twists are similar to cornrows but gentler on your scalp, and when you turn them into an updo, you’ve got a look that’s both elegant and easy to maintain.
I love that this style is so chic—it’s perfect for a day at the office or a night out.
This style works for most hair textures and gives a lot of flexibility, so you can experiment with how you want to twist it.
